At present, rice is in the tillering stage, and rice planthoppers are prone to occur in high temperature and high humidity. Rice planthoppers in the rice areas of South China, Jiangnan and southwestern China will occur more heavily, and the rice areas in the middle and lower reaches of the Yangtze River will occur moderately. It is recommended that all localities should grasp the pest situation in time and spray pesticides in a timely manner. Linyi Fertilizer Network Copyright

Dome lenses are hemispheres. The two optical surfaces are an equal thickness apart, creating a naturally strong shape that gets tougher under pressure. This makes dome windows ideal for underwater environments and in applications such as camera dome ports and submersible windows.
BK7 or K9L domes are used primarily in meteorology applications. BK7 offers excellent transmission from 300nm up to 2µm. BK7 is a relatively hard material, with excellent chemical durability.
UV fused silica domes ( JGS1 ): For applications operating in the deeper UV range, we offers a range of UV fused silica domes. Fused silica domes are commonly used in underwater applications at extremely high pressures.

Sapphire domes: For infrared applications we can provide sapphire domes. Sapphire is an extremely hard material with transmission of over 80% in the 2-5µm wavelength range. As with fused silica, sapphire is able to withstand extreme pressures, making it the perfect material for underwater camera and missile fairing applications.
